Output d2d59fcfe1eeacd3bf4653442b50986c85de3b8d543e561035cac12da26d63d4:5

value
11640892
script pubkey
OP_0 OP_PUSHBYTES_20 6630a13f8a41a8fddc245405d48eeaec1b07e4c5
address
ltc1qvcc2z0u2gx50mhpy2szafrh2asds0ex9lzkg7k
transaction
d2d59fcfe1eeacd3bf4653442b50986c85de3b8d543e561035cac12da26d63d4
spent
true